What are the driving forces behind a man's inclination to defend his partner in a polygamous relationship?

In a polygamous marriage, a husband's motivations for protection can stem from various sources, including:

  • Fear of losing the partner: A deep-seated worry about losing the loved one due to separation or infidelity can drive a husband to become overly protective.

  • Cultural and societal pressures: Men may feel compelled to adhere to traditional expectations of masculinity and act as guardians of their partner(s).

  • Emotional dependence: Strong emotional bonds within the relationship can lead to a heightened sense of responsibility and duty to safeguard the partner.

Are there realistic risks associated with a husband's righteous rage?

While a husband's protective instincts can manifest in different ways, it's essential to acknowledge potential risks associated with excessive or all-consuming protection. These risks can include:

  • Cascading possession: Overly controlling behavior can lead to the erasure of mutual respect and trust within the relationship.

  • Emotional confinement: Restrictive actions can limit the partner's freedom and autonomy, causing feelings of suffocation.

  • Escalation: Excessive protection can escalate tensions and conflict within the relationship or among other partners.
